Discover the Natural Splendor of Montagne du Diable Regional Park

Montagne du Diable Regional Park is a hidden gem in Quebec, beckoning tourists with its stunning natural beauty and outdoor recreational opportunities. This expansive park is renowned for its breathtaking landscapes, featuring rolling hills, dense forests, and crystal-clear lakes, making it an ideal destination for nature enthusiasts and adventure seekers. The park boasts a network of well-maintained hiking trails that wind through diverse ecosystems, allowing visitors to immerse themselves in the tranquility of nature. Whether you're an avid hiker or a casual walker, you'll find trails suited to your skill level, each offering unique views and experiences. In addition to hiking, Montagne du Diable offers a plethora of activities for every season. During the warmer months, visitors can enjoy canoeing, kayaking, or fishing in the park's serene waters, while winter transforms the landscape into a snowy wonderland perfect for snowshoeing and cross-country skiing. The park is also home to a variety of wildlife, providing excellent opportunities for birdwatching and photography. Moreover, the park's facilities include picnic areas and rest spots where families can relax and enjoy the beauty surrounding them. With its rich biodiversity, picturesque scenery, and a range of outdoor activities, Montagne du Diable Regional Park is a must-visit destination for anyone looking to experience the natural wonders of Quebec.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ving from the town of Mont-Tremblant, take Route 117 North towards Ferme-Neuve. Continue on Route 117 for approximately 50 km until you reach Ferme-Neuve. Once in Ferme-Neuve, turn left onto Chemin Léandre-Meilleur. Follow this road for about 5 km, and you will arrive at Montagne du Diable Regional Park, located at 1100 Chemin Léandre-Meilleur, Ferme-Neuve, QC J0W 1C0. There is a parking area available at the park entrance.

  • Public Transportation

    To reach Montagne du Diable Regional Park using public transportation, start by taking a bus from Mont-Tremblant to Ferme-Neuve. Check the schedule for the bus service that operates on this route, as it may vary. Once you arrive in Ferme-Neuve, you will need to take a taxi or rideshare service to get to the park, as public transit options are limited in this area. The park is approximately 5 km from the Ferme-Neuve bus station, and taxi fares may vary around CAD 10-15.

  • Bicycle

    For the adventurous, biking to Montagne du Diable Regional Park is an option if you're in the surrounding areas. From Mont-Tremblant, you can cycle along Route 117 North. It's approximately a 50 km ride, and the route is relatively scenic. Ensure your bike is in good condition and bring necessary supplies as there are limited services along the way. Once in Ferme-Neuve, follow Chemin Léandre-Meilleur to the park entrance.
